Description
Whoop is a wearable health and fitness platform that uses continuous biometric sensors and AI-driven analytics to deliver personalized insights on recovery, strain, and sleep rather than functioning as a workout generator. The band tracks heart rate, heart rate variability, respiratory rate, and sleep quality around the clock, and the accompanying app translates that data into daily Recovery and Strain scores that guide how hard a user should train that day. Unlike most wearable brands, Whoop sells a membership rather than hardware, bundling the device itself into the subscription rather than charging for it separately, with new bands rolled into existing memberships as they launch. The top WHOOP MG tier adds medical-grade sensors for blood oxygen and skin temperature, including ECG and AFib detection, though those specific medical features are not yet FDA-cleared.

How It Works
A user wears the Whoop band continuously, and its sensors capture heart rate, HRV, respiratory rate, and sleep data around the clock rather than only during logged workouts. Each morning, the app combines that overnight data into a Recovery score, giving a simple signal for how much strain the body can handle that day, and throughout the day it tracks cumulative Strain from both exercise and general activity, comparing it against the morning’s recovery reading. Sleep coach analyzes sleep stages and quality overnight, offering specific recommendations tied to a user’s own patterns rather than generic sleep hygiene advice. On the WHOOP MG tier, additional sensors for blood oxygen and skin temperature feed into broader health monitoring, including ECG-based heart rhythm checks, though these clinical-facing features remain outside FDA clearance as of this writing.
Technical Architecture & Overview
- Core Engine: Proprietary AI-driven biometric analytics processing continuous sensor data into Recovery, Strain, and Sleep scores.
- Deployment: Whoop 5.0 wearable band, paired with iOS and Android apps.
- API Surface: No general consumer-facing developer API confirmed on the official site.
- Known Limits: The device requires an active membership to function and won’t sync data without one; medical-grade features on WHOOP MG are not yet FDA-cleared.

Pricing
| Plan | Price |
|---|---|
| WHOOP One | $199/year (core tracking) |
| WHOOP Peak | $239/year (adds sleep/strain coach, healthspan, stress monitor) |
| WHOOP Life | $359/year (adds WHOOP MG hardware with ECG and AFib detection) |
